  • I own a 2002 lexus ls in dec. 2010, while I was taking the groceries out of my trunk, the trunk fell on my head and created an injury to my eyes, I had two surgeries, the trunk unexpectedly just crash on my head, it was very painful, I almost passed out,apparently the springs wore out, there was no…

    filed Apr 10, 2012

  • Failed component: 2 hydraulic supporters on trunk lid. Complaints: the 2 hydraulic supporters on trunk lid were completely failed. I was injured on october 29, 2011 when the lid felled down (closed) on its own weight and hit my head and then my right arm. The supporters are very weak as compared to the trunk lid heavy…

    filed Nov 7, 2011
